All Categories
Featured
Table of Contents
By the end of this area, you will have a solid understanding of the technological facets you require to concentrate on to master Opn's design interview. Proceeding to Component 2 of our blog series, we will certainly change our attention to behavior questions and what to anticipate throughout the interview procedure.
We likewise make use of Google Jamboard for the layout round. Our meeting procedure at Opn is uncomplicated, and we guarantee you are well-prepared for the technological rounds.
The technical meeting contains two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 minutes to reply to questions and 10 minutes for Q&A. Depending upon the availability of both the prospect and the job interviewer, these rounds may happen on different days.
Perhaps, it has actually been a long time given that you last touched them, so take sufficient time to return to practice. Comprehend the ideas, study the phrase structure really thoroughly, and obtain accustomed to various ways of reacting to the concerns. Throughout the interview, prior to attempting to create your service, you might intend to initial make clear the concern with the recruiter, analyze the issue, and information the reasoning and why you will pick this strategy to resolving the problem.
It is vital to direct out that the job interviewers desire you to do well and exist to support you. Rationale for you is to show the job interviewer exactly how you assume, connect, and whether you can fix troubles. By doing so, you have actually opened the floor to involve extra with the interviewer and welcome any type of suggestions related to tackling the coding problems.
Still, it prevails among our recruiters to ask questions around the subject of repayment portals as this will certainly be most appropriate to your everyday work. In the layout round, candidates are encouraged to supply their optimal software application style design to apply a hypothetical solution under certain restrictions. Inquiries can include: Layout a settlement system for an ecommerce platform.
When being talked to and throughout coding rounds, it's valuable to repeat the inquiries to the interviewer to guarantee that both of you are on the same web page. If you don't understand, feel cost-free to ask the job interviewer to repeat or put in other words the inquiry.
Riley right here! I've been a complete workdesk technological employer for nearly 10 years. Many of my time has been invested as a company employer with Code Skill, but I likewise have a year of internal recruiting experience on Twitter's Profits Platform group. I've developed this overview by making use of my exposure to both huge technology and start-up hiring.
I want to flag that the recommendations supplied is based upon my personal viewpoints and experience, and need to not be thought about a recommendation of the working with processes made use of in large tech, or by business emulating big tech hiring. Instead, it is planned to supply guidance on exactly how to navigate the "industry requirement" interview procedure and improve your opportunities of success.
But in all severity, you can tell a great deal concerning your positioning to a company and their worths based on this web page. Furthermore, websites like Glassdoor and Blind can give beneficial understandings right into the company's interview procedure, staff member experiences, and incomes. It's likewise an excellent concept to investigate your interviewer and their function to obtain a better understanding of their perspective and what they may be searching for in a candidate.
Exactly how has the meeting process been so much? Frequently our impulses are effective tools that are overlooked; it's vital to resolve any type of appointments about the role or firm before proceeding with the process.
Deal with every practice as a meeting; it might even help with those video game day nerves! In the 'Knowledge is Power' area, I pointed out the relevance of identifying company values.
Additionally, the celebrity technique will assist you develop responses to prospective behavior meeting questions. Create STAR examples for each bullet in the task summary (if there are also numerous bullets, gather themes). Behavior meeting questions are frequently taken directly from these task summary bullet points. As an example: Solid analytical abilities, with the ability to think creatively and tactically to solve intricate technical obstacles -> Tell me about a time you encountered barriers and difficulties at job.
By showing good collaboration skills, explaining their believed processes, and most importantly, their blunders. Throughout the technical interview, maintain these inquiries in mind: Have you collected your needs? Are you checking in with your job interviewer?
Ask for a moment. It's alright to take a break. Being honest and prone (when safe) can aid you stand out from other candidates.
Bear in mind, you're freaking awesome, and your unique high qualities and experiences can aid you land your dream work so long as it's the ideal fit for you. Are you still not really feeling good regarding this? All good, and I entirely comprehend. Below's a listing of business that do not white boards or follow "standard technology" interview processes, phew.
Do have a look at all these inquiries with responses from below: Software Design Interview Questions is the process of developing, establishing, testing, and keeping software application. It is an organized and regimented strategy to software program advancement that intends to create premium, trustworthy, and maintainable software application. Software application engineers produce software options for end individuals by utilizing design principles and their understanding of shows languages.
It is an attributes of software that describes its ability to execute what it was designed to do properly and consistently in time. It refers to the level to which the software can be used with simplicity. The amount of effort or time called for to learn just how to utilize the software application.
It describes exactly how basic it is to improve and change the software. It describes how conveniently a software system can be modified to add function, enhance rate, or repair work faults. It describes just how well the software can work with various platforms or circumstances without making major modifications.
For more information please refer to the following short article Features of Software application. The software program is utilized extensively in several domains including hospitals, financial institutions, schools, defense, finance, stock markets, and more. It can be categorized into various kinds: For even more details please refer to the complying with article Categories of Software application.
It is defined by a structured, sequential approach to project monitoring and software advancement. It is good to utilize this model when the modern technology is well recognized.
Beta screening commonly makes use of black-box screening. Alpha testing is executed by testers that are generally internal employees of the organization. Beta testing is executed by customers who are not part of the company. Alpha testing is done at the programmer's website. Beta screening is carried out at the end-user, the of the product.
Reliability, safety, and robustness are inspected during beta screening. Alpha testing makes certain the top quality of the product before forwarding it to beta screening. Beta testing also focuses on the high quality of the item but gathers the customer's time-long input on the item and makes sure that the item awaits real-time users.
Table of Contents
Latest Posts
10 Proven Strategies To Ace Your Next Software Engineering Interview
The Definitive Guide to Data Science - Uc Berkeley Extension
What Does Ai Integrated Data Science Course Online Do?
More
Latest Posts
10 Proven Strategies To Ace Your Next Software Engineering Interview
The Definitive Guide to Data Science - Uc Berkeley Extension
What Does Ai Integrated Data Science Course Online Do?